Hello Harry and ldng, The linux-image-2.6.24-16-openvz package in the official repository for some reason was compiled without the latest patches, however if you compiled your own kernel from the official ubuntu kernel git you will end up with a linux-image-2.6.24-16-openvz package which after installation and reboot will give you a fully functional openvz patched system.
You can find the instruction about how to compile the kernel from the git above.
